RMS 值高于 0 dbFS?

信息处理 声音的
2021-12-28 01:04:37

我想知道为什么我用于音乐制作的几个 RMS 仪表显示 RMS 值高于 0。

例如,当使用恒定 DC 为 1 (0 dbFS) 的输入信号时,我得到了这些结果,尽管维基百科说在这种情况下,RMS 等于直流电流的幅度。

幅度 Pro X (RMS: 2.9)

在此处输入图像描述

TT 动态范围表 (RMS 3.0)

在此处输入图像描述

而其他仪表显示我期望的值:

Voxengo 跨度 (RMS: 0.0)

在此处输入图像描述

为什么仪表会得出如此不同的结果?

1个回答

0 dBFS 指的是满量程正弦波,或者更罕见的是满量程方波。

ITU-T 电话建议书。P.381P.382以及付费数字音频设备测量标准AES17-1998和 IEC 61606 定义满量程正弦波为 0 dBFS。ITU-T 建议书 P.10/G.100 (11/2017) 没有做出区分,并将 dBfs (sic) 定义为“以分贝表示的相对功率电平,指的是最大可能的数字电平(满量程)”

满量程 DC 与满量程方波具有相同的 RMS 值,但如果 0 dBFS 参考是满量程正弦波,则为 3.010299956 dBFS RMS。看起来不同的程序使用不同的参考(正方形或正弦)。Samplitude Pro X 可能会使用一些 RMS 近似值,在这种情况下会产生 0.1 dB 的单位误差。

计算:

02πsin(x)2dx2π=12
10log10(12)3.010299956